Here’s a clear, step-by-step guide for making a Café-Style Iced Americano using a stovetop method—no espresso machine needed. I’ll keep it simple, fast, and refreshing.

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ons (10–12 g) finely ground coffee (medium-fine grind)
  • 1 cup (240 ml) hot water
  • Ice cubes
  • Optional: a splash of milk or sweetener

Equipment

  • Stovetop coffee maker (Moka pot) or small saucepan
  • Spoon
  • Glass for serving

Step-by-Step Method

  1. Brew the coffee
    • Heat water in a Moka pot or saucepan.
    • Add the coffee grounds.
    • If using a saucepan, pour hot water over coffee grounds and let it steep for 3–4 minutes.
    • Strain the coffee through a fine sieve or coffee filter into a cup.
  2. Cool the coffee slightly
    • Let it sit for 1–2 minutes; you want it hot enough to dissolve sweetness but not so hot it melts the ice immediately.
  3. Prepare your glass
    • Fill a tall glass about ¾ full with ice cubes.
  4. Pour over ice
    • Slowly pour the brewed coffee over the ice. This instantly chills it and gives that refreshing Iced Americano texture.
  5. Top with water
    • Add cold water to taste. Classic Iced Americano is roughly 1 part coffee : 1–2 parts water.
  6. Optional finishing touches
    • Sweeten with sugar, honey, or syrup if desired.
    • Add a splash of milk or non-dairy alternative for creaminess.
    • Stir gently and enjoy immediately.

💡 Pro Tips

  • Use freshly ground coffee for best flavor.
  • Avoid pouring hot coffee directly on ice—it dilutes the flavor too fast. Let it cool slightly.
  • For a stronger taste, brew with slightly more coffee grounds than usual.
